Side-by-side comparison of Henderson State University and John Brown University (2024 data).
| Metric | Henderson State University | John Brown University |
|---|---|---|
| Location | Arkadelphia, AR | Siloam Springs, AR |
| Type | Public | Private |
| In-State Tuition | $8,244 | $31,756 |
| Out-of-State Tuition | $10,620 | $31,756 |
| Acceptance Rate | 70.0% | 76.1% |
| SAT Average | 1099.7 | 1195 |
| Enrollment | 1,456 | 1,471 |
| Graduation Rate | 37.6% | 69.3% |
| Median Debt | $19,500 | $21,250 |
| Median Earnings (10yr) | $43,459 | $53,907 |
